Maison > interface Web > tutoriel CSS > le corps du texte

Comment faire pivoter des éléments dans IE9 à l'aide de la transformation CSS3 : rotation ; ?

Linda Hamilton
Libérer: 2024-11-10 11:39:02
original
452 Les gens l'ont consulté

How to Rotate Elements in IE9 Using CSS3 Transform: rotate; ?

Rotation CSS3 : rotation ; Transformer dans IE9

Il est courant de rencontrer des problèmes de compatibilité lorsque l'on essaie d'utiliser les propriétés CSS3 dans différents navigateurs. Un de ces problèmes est rencontré lors de la tentative de rotation d'éléments dans Internet Explorer 9 (IE9) à l'aide de la transformation CSS3 : rotate; property.

IE9 ne prend pas en charge la propriété de transformation CSS3 de manière native, comme il l'a fait avec IE7 et IE8 en utilisant la propriété filter. Cependant, un préfixe de fournisseur peut être utilisé pour surmonter cette limitation.

Pour faire pivoter un élément dans IE9 à l'aide de CSS3, utilisez la syntaxe suivante :

-ms-transform: rotate(10deg);
Copier après la connexion

Le préfixe "-ms-" signifie que le style est destiné aux navigateurs basés sur Microsoft, tels que IE9.

Notez qu'en appliquant transform: rotate; à un élément sans le préfixe du fournisseur peut rendre l'élément transparent dans IE9. De plus, la propriété filter est obsolète dans IE9 et ne doit pas être utilisée.

Pour plus de ressources, reportez-vous aux liens suivants :

  • http://css3please.com/ : Un terrain de test pour diverses fonctionnalités CSS3 dans tous les navigateurs.
  • www.canIuse.com/#search=rotation : Un tableau résumant la prise en charge des navigateurs pour divers CSS fonctionnalités, y compris la rotation.
  • CSS Sandpaper : un hack qui permet la prise en charge des transformations CSS standard dans les anciennes versions d'IE.

En utilisant les techniques décrites ci-dessus, il est possible d'obtenir des éléments rotation dans IE9 à l'aide des transformations CSS3, garantissant la compatibilité entre navigateurs et conservant l'esthétique de conception souhaitée.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al